PERFORMANCE EVALUATION FORMS
Performance management is more than the annual performance evaluation meeting and report; it is an ongoing process. For performance evaluations to be successful, managers must regularly evaluate their employee’s performance and not put off reviewing employees until their review dates.
Many times managers view performance evaluations as a record of employee performance only. However, evaluations also reflect how well supervisors communicate and otherwise relate to their subordinates. Additionally, a well-prepared evaluation may protect an organization as far as documentation.
WHY DO PERFORMANCE EVALUATIONS?
Properly prepared performance evaluations are good for you as a manager! Here’s why:
They positively affect employees’ performance by:
• Identifying ongoing performance problems • Addressing new problems as they emerge • Reinforcing positive behavior by providing positive feedback on what was done correctly • Increasing employees’ self-awareness • Encouraging improvement • Providing guidance and suggestions for improved performance • Increasing employee motivation
They enhance communication because they:
• Clarify job responsibilities • Increase employees’ feelings of involvement • Provide information about the cause of a problem
They enhance managers’ professional development because they:
• Force you to regularly review routine tasks, skills needed and work conditions • Evaluate productivity and help you to gain control over the conditions that affect productivity

VENUE INSPECTIONS (Quarterly & Annually)
Without a building inspection, the assets of your building will de-value, may become a safety issue for team members or Guests, and will affect the way Guests feel about the cleanliness of your venue.
Without a health inspection, your restaurant could fall victim to a foodborne illness outbreak that could ruin your establishment’s reputation and even force you to close your doors.
Inspections give you a format to make sure you have consistency in your standards of cleanliness, organization, preventative maintenance programs, repairs and maintenance programs, and can provide you with sidework daily and weekly tasks for “to do lists” for your team members.
